Rahul Gandhi Ballot Pitch Paper Says Not ‘Made in China’, however ‘Made in Bihar’


In a fiery speech, Congress chief Rahul Gandhi criticises the Narendra Modi-led BJP authorities on a number of fronts, together with its alleged opposition to social justice, the recurring problem of examination paper leaks in states like Bihar, and insurance policies that he claims have decimated small companies. Gandhi said, ‘Ek taraf natak Ambani adani ka Hindustan Narendra Modi ka grama aur tushree taraf Hindustan Ki sachchaai ganda paani bimari’ (‘On one aspect, there may be the drama of Ambani-Adani’s India, Narendra Modi’s drama, and on the opposite aspect, the fact of India: soiled water and illness’). He contrasts the struggles of frequent folks, equivalent to college students dealing with rigged exams and sufferers from Bihar compelled to hunt remedy in Delhi, with the federal government’s alleged favouritism in the direction of just a few industrialists. Gandhi champions a caste census for equitable illustration and guarantees a shift from ‘Made in China’ to ‘Made in Bihar’ to spice up native employment and business.
